Appearance
Windows 本地部署教程
说实话,一开始我也觉得在 Windows 上部署酒馆挺复杂的,但其实真的不难,跟着步骤走,你也能成功!
强烈建议
不要使用任何一键安装、一键脚本、一键包!
为什么呢?安全性无法保证,部分电脑可能会报错,对于新手来说,手动安装反而能避免很多问题。相信我,跟着这个教程一步步来,真的不难!
一、安装前置软件
这一步的目的:安装两个必需的工具(Git 和 Node.js),它们是运行酒馆的基础。
第一步:确认你的系统架构
右键点击开始菜单 → 选择"系统" → 查看"设备规格":
- x64 架构 - 最常见 ✅
- ARM64 架构 - 部分笔记本 ✅
- x86 架构 - 32 位系统 ❌(不支持)
如果你的系统是 32 位的,就没法继续了哦。需要换一台 64 位的电脑。
第二步:安装 Git
这一步的目的:Git 是用来从网上下载酒馆代码的工具,必须先安装它。
下载地址:https://git-scm.com/downloads/win
根据你的架构选择对应版本,下载后双击安装,全程点 Next,不要改任何设置。
安装完成后,按 Win + R → 输入 cmd → 回车,打开命令行窗口。
输入这个命令验证安装:
cmd
git -v这行命令在干什么?
检查 Git 是否安装成功。如果显示版本号(比如 git version 2.xx.x),就说明安装成功啦!
第三步:安装 Node.js
这一步的目的:Node.js 是运行酒馆必需的环境。简单来说,酒馆是用 JavaScript 写的,Node.js 就是让 JavaScript 能在电脑上运行的工具。
下载地址:https://nodejs.org/zh-cn/download
根据你的架构选择对应版本,下载后双击安装,全程点 Next,不要改任何设置。
安装完成后,在刚才打开的 CMD 窗口中输入:
cmd
node -v这行命令在干什么?
检查 Node.js 是否安装成功。看到版本号就说明没问题了。
再输入:
cmd
npm -v这行命令在干什么?
检查 npm(Node.js 的包管理器)是否安装成功。npm 用来安装酒馆需要的各种依赖包。
二、配置国内镜像源
这一步的目的:把下载源从国外改成国内,避免网络问题导致安装失败。
第一步:切换下载源
这行命令在干什么?
把 npm 的下载源从国外改成国内镜像(npmmirror),这样下载依赖包的时候会快很多,也更稳定。
在 CMD 窗口中输入:
cmd
npm config set registry https://registry.npmmirror.com第二步:验证配置
这行命令在干什么?
确认一下刚才的配置是否生效。
输入:
cmd
npm config get registry如果显示 https://registry.npmmirror.com,就说明配置成功,可以关闭 CMD 了。
小贴士
如果以后想换回官方源,输入 npm config set registry https://registry.npmjs.org 就行。
三、创建安装目录
这一步的目的:为酒馆创建一个专门的文件夹,避免到处乱放。
第一步:新建文件夹
这一步在干什么?
在 D 盘(或其他盘)创建一个专门存放酒馆的文件夹。注意不要用中文名字,也不要放在桌面或者太深的路径里。
- 在 D 盘新建一个文件夹,命名为
SillyTavern - 右键文件夹 → 属性 → 安全 → 编辑
- 将所有用户都设置为"完全控制"
重要提醒
- 不要用中文路径,避免报错
- 可以装在 C 盘,但建议装在 D 盘或其他盘,这样重装系统不会丢失数据
四、下载酒馆
这一步的目的:从网上下载酒馆的代码文件。
第一步:打开命令行
这一步在干什么?
在酒馆文件夹里打开命令行窗口,这样下载的代码就会直接保存在这个文件夹里。
- 打开刚才创建的
SillyTavern文件夹 - 点击地址栏空白处 → 输入
cmd→ 回车 - 在新打开的 CMD 窗口中输入:
cmd
git clone https://github.com/SillyTavern/SillyTavern.git -b release这行命令在干什么?
从 GitHub 官方仓库下载酒馆代码,-b release 表示下载稳定版分支。
等待下载完成(看到 done 和 100% 表示成功),然后关闭 CMD。
提示
如果下载速度太慢,可以换成国内镜像:
cmd
git clone https://gitee.com/laopobao/SillyTavern.git -b release五、安装运行环境
这一步的目的:安装酒馆运行所需的依赖文件,就像给游戏安装补丁一样。
第一步:安装依赖
这一步在干什么?
运行 npm install 命令,让 npm 自动下载并安装酒馆需要的所有依赖包。这可能需要几分钟,耐心等待就好。
- 打开
D:\SillyTavern\SillyTavern文件夹(注意是里面的那个文件夹) - 点击地址栏空白处 → 输入
cmd→ 回车 - 在新打开的 CMD 窗口中输入:
cmd
npm install这行命令在干什么?
让 npm 读取 package.json 文件,自动下载并安装所有需要的依赖包。
等待安装完成,看到新的命令行提示符出现,就说明成功了!然后关闭 CMD。
六、启动酒馆
这一步的目的:运行酒馆服务,让酒馆在你的电脑上运行起来!
第一步:启动酒馆
这一步在干什么?
双击运行启动脚本,酒馆就会开始运行,然后自动打开浏览器。
- 进入
D:\SillyTavern\SillyTavern文件夹 - 找到
Start.bat文件,双击打开 - 等待黑色窗口出现启动信息
- 浏览器会自动打开酒馆(或手动访问
http://127.0.0.1:8000)
小贴士
第一次启动会比较慢,可能需要等一两分钟,后面再启动就会快很多了。
千万要注意
在使用酒馆的过程中,这个黑色的 CMD 窗口不能关闭!
它必须一直运行,酒馆才能正常使用。你可以把它最小化,但不能关掉。
日常使用技巧
创建桌面快捷方式
右键 Start.bat → 发送到 → 桌面快捷方式 → 重命名为"启动酒馆"
以后直接双击就能启动了!
更新酒馆
找到 UpdateAndStart.bat 文件,双击运行即可自动更新并启动。
注意
不要使用 UpdateForkAndStart.bat 文件!
常见问题
Q: 安装过程中出现错误怎么办?
检查网络、确认是否安装了正确架构的版本、确认是否更改了安装路径。
Q: 为什么不能用中文路径?
中文路径会导致程序无法正确读取文件,出现各种奇怪的错误。
Q: 可以装在 C 盘吗?
可以!Git 和 Node.js 体积不大,装在 C 盘没问题。
最后想说
其实部署真的很简单,只要你按部就班地来,肯定能成功!
遇到问题?欢迎加入我们的 QQ 群:216189515
下一步:
